Internation-al turnaround thoughts

Hi everybody!

Just thinking about some years of experience spent in the IT industry and its different platform flavors (and the taste in the mouth after them) and giving a try along the various ramifications of which such endeavors may become, just trying to obtain some conclusions:

It is sometimes difficult to distinguish between those endeavors regarding the accomplishments and tasks a developer must face in its diary labours. The most part of the time we are offering 'consultancy' services in which we maintain, enhance and extend existing deployed applications.

But, in a little bit more rare cases we're faced to begin an application endeavor from scratch. Some times the line separating those two situations is a little bit blurry. No application exists 'from scratch' today using whatever frameworks or whatsoever.

In an excess of simplification I would like to summarize my experience in both fields. Below each explanation I'm attaching a picture that somewhat …